Anybody ever taken the cursed soft bushings from the suppliers and had replicas ground out of very hard tool steel at a machine shop? Seems to me that it might be cost effective if you do a lot of the same pens.

I thought the same thing about the soft bushings but I decided to use calipers instead. I'm glad I went that route because I discovered that some of the bushings were slightly off of the finished dimentions of the corresponding metal part that they were designed to match. Using calipers to measure the metal part first and then using that measurement as the finished dimention of the wood ensures that the fit is dead on.
